Although this piece is very heavy in most cases, the wire is not that heavy. At some point it just breaks and then the whole thing is unusable. I've considered buying stainless steel wire, but changing the wire is quite frustrating and a bit difficult. The wire is a lot thicker than other planes I've used. Possibly almost twice as thick or even thicker, making the cheese difficult to cut, which in turn defeated the purpose of a dedicated cut for cheese. One day I'll probably break down and try thinner wire and I'll write back if/when I do. When I was still using it, before it broke again, the wire always seemed to sag, meaning all my cuts were uneven, and the screws started breaking out after the 20th time adjusting the wire. Although the wire is very close to the edge of this slicer, there is an uncut piece of cheese at the end of the cut. If you cut in the air this problem goes away, but the cutting becomes much more difficult and care still needs to be taken to get a good clean cut. This slicer has potential, but thick wire and tricky wire tensioners are problematic. Hope. Someone will find this review helpful!
